Поделиться через


AccountsOperations interface

Интерфейс, представляющий операции учетных записей.

Свойства

checkNameAvailability

Добавляет проверку глобальной операции доступности имен, обычно используемой, если имя ресурса должно быть глобально уникальным.

createOrUpdate

Создание учетной записи

delete

Удаление учетной записи

get

Получение учетной записи

listByResourceGroup

Вывод списка ресурсов учетной записи по группе ресурсов

listBySubscription

Вывод списка ресурсов учетной записи по идентификатору подписки

update

Обновление учетной записи

Сведения о свойстве

checkNameAvailability

Добавляет проверку глобальной операции доступности имен, обычно используемой, если имя ресурса должно быть глобально уникальным.

checkNameAvailability: (body: CheckNameAvailabilityRequest, options?: AccountsCheckNameAvailabilityOptionalParams) => Promise<CheckNameAvailabilityResponse>

Значение свойства

(body: CheckNameAvailabilityRequest, options?: AccountsCheckNameAvailabilityOptionalParams) => Promise<CheckNameAvailabilityResponse>

createOrUpdate

Создание учетной записи

createOrUpdate: (resourceGroupName: string, accountName: string, resource: Account, options?: AccountsCreateOrUpdateOptionalParams) => PollerLike<OperationState<Account>, Account>

Значение свойства

(resourceGroupName: string, accountName: string, resource: Account, options?: AccountsCreateOrUpdateOptionalParams) => PollerLike<OperationState<Account>, Account>

delete

Удаление учетной записи

delete: (resourceGroupName: string, accountName: string, options?: AccountsDeleteOptionalParams) => PollerLike<OperationState<void>, void>

Значение свойства

(resourceGroupName: string, accountName: string, options?: AccountsDeleteOptionalParams) => PollerLike<OperationState<void>, void>

get

Получение учетной записи

get: (resourceGroupName: string, accountName: string, options?: AccountsGetOptionalParams) => Promise<Account>

Значение свойства

(resourceGroupName: string, accountName: string, options?: AccountsGetOptionalParams) => Promise<Account>

listByResourceGroup

Вывод списка ресурсов учетной записи по группе ресурсов

listByResourceGroup: (resourceGroupName: string, options?: AccountsList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<Account, Account[], PageSettings>

Значение свойства

(resourceGroupName: string, options?: AccountsList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<Account, Account[], PageSettings>

listBySubscription

Вывод списка ресурсов учетной записи по идентификатору подписки

listBySubscription: (options?: AccountsListBySubscriptionOptionalParams) => PagedAsyncIterableIterator<Account, Account[], PageSettings>

Значение свойства

(options?: AccountsListBySubscriptionOptionalParams) => PagedAsyncIterableIterator<Account, Account[], PageSettings>

update

Обновление учетной записи

update: (resourceGroupName: string, accountName: string, properties: AccountUpdate, options?: AccountsUpdateOptionalParams) => Promise<Account>

Значение свойства

(resourceGroupName: string, accountName: string, properties: AccountUpdate, options?: AccountsUpdateOptionalParams) => Promise<Account>